About the Role
UW Medical Center - Northwest has an outstanding opportunity for a Nurse Care Coordinator to join our Care Management team with the goal of achieving coordinated patient flow through an inpatient stay, culminating in a safe and timely discharge. This position works closely with all members of the interdisciplinary health care team, ensuring that the team is aware of the patient’s plan of care and that all disciplines are working toward the same goals for the patient.

Responsibilities
- Identification and monitoring of high medical needs patients to ensure timely completion of consults, procedures, and tests, ongoing team communication, and facilitates coordination between providers across the continuum of care.
- Lead medical team and nursing huddles and work creatively on removing barriers to discharge due to medical complications and/or system or team obstacles.
- Assist with ordering complex medical equipment and in ensuring safe transitions of care.
- Develop and monitor outcome measures related to care coordination and staff and patient satisfaction with discharge planning.
- Provide ongoing consultation and education to staff on how to achieve improved patient flow through the UWMC system.
